SSI not working now that we changed servers (hosts) Can't Post

Hi there-

We used several server side includes to bring groups of listings into pages, and they've worked great - BUT - we switched hosts and it's not working now.

Also worth noting is that I can't seem to republish listings through the admin either. I can make some changes - but cannot republish listings... does nothing... (or appears to do nothing).

Here's the include code we are using:
<!--#include virtual="/cgi-bin/listman/exec/search.cgi?search=1&perpage=100&lfield3_keyword=yes&user_num=1&template=_featured_listing_index.html" -->

Weird thing is that I can run in include like this for the file modified date and it works. So, concluding that ssi is working - it's something with realty manager or the cgi-bin?

Or is it a server problem?

I can do searches in the realty manager web site? No problem there.
Just can't do the SSI.


The server logs don't show much detail - just this:
[Fri Feb 20 11:41:24 2009] [error] [client 69.54.33.229] unable to include potential exec "/cgi-bin/listman/exec/search.cgi?search=1&perpage=100&lfield3_keyword=yes&user_num=1&template=_featured_listing_index.html" in parsed file /home/public_html/index.shtml

Anyone have any ideas...?

Couldn't test this, as IT support said that nothing through the CGI-Bin would work until dns changed over. It's changed, and this part is broken...

Thanks in advance!

Hi Jeff,

I've already responded to this via email, but for anyone else who comes across this... take a look at the "publishcron" script available as a part of this tutorial:

http://www.interactivetools.com/products/listingsmanager/tutorials/tutorial_lm_rss.html

This allows you to create a static page out of any dynamically executed script, which should be able to be included then. :)
